Description of the Artwork “Elvis has left the building”

Elvis has left the building is an oil on canvas with gold leaf and acrylic paste, cm 80x120. I wanted to portray Elvis as determined to leave the money-making machine that chewed him, unfortunately. The spotlight light on the stage is made in gold leaf as well as the decorations on Elvis' jacket. The graffiti on the textured wall behind him are part of the lyrics of My Way song which Elvis recorded a wonderful cover of. Signed on its back with certificate of authenticity, ready to hang.

About the artist

Born in Milan, Simona Zecca is a self-taught artist who has always loved drawing and art since childhood and has always continued to cultivate her passion for art even during her studies and in the period in which she worked. in marketing. She loves studying new and various techniques and over the years she deepened the use of graphite, colored pencils, watercolor, acrylic, airbrush and oil, which is currently his favorite technique. In 2015 she decided to follow the ever-present call of art to which she began to devote herself full time from 2016, initially customizing mainly helmets and motorcycle parts with airbrush and at the same time expressing herself through his paintings on canvas. In 2019 she began to exhibit her artworks, immediately receiving an excellent response from the public and critics and obtaining various awards. Initially hyper-realistic, she is now expressesing herself through a modern realism and prefers female portraits. She has always been particularly focused on the expressiveness of the gaze.
